Washington Trust Announces Promotions

January 9, 2009 (Westerly, RI). . .Washington Trust announces the following employee promotions:

Melanie A. Connelly, a resident of Charlestown, R.I., has been promoted to branch operations officer. Connelly joined the Bank in 1999 as a pro-team associate. She was promoted to head teller in 2000, and to assistant branch manager in 2005. Connelly assists the sales & service team, as well as performing teller functions. She is a Certified Professional Teller, and has completed the Bank's Management Certification Program.

Kim L. Kaplan, a resident of Cranston, R.I., has been promoted to lending support officer. Kaplan joined the Bank in 2008 as the lending support manager in the secondary market department. She has more than 10 years of mortgage lending, banking and management experience. She is responsible for the supervision of investor reporting and remitting for all investors, and the escrow and insurance functions of the department. Kaplan has a Bachelor of Arts degree from the University of Rhode Island.

Donna M. Massiwer, a resident of West Greenwich, R.I., has been promoted to accounts payable officer. Massiwer joined the Bank in 2004 as the deposit operations supervisor. In 2006, she became an accounts payable specialist in the financial administration department. She is responsible for preparing and paying invoices and employee reimbursement requests, maintaining the accounts payable system, and preparing periodic sales and use tax reports.

The Washington Trust Company is a subsidiary of Washington Trust Bancorp, Inc., a $2.8 billion corporation headquartered in Westerly, Rhode Island. Founded in 1800, Washington Trust is the oldest community bank in the nation and is the largest independent bank headquartered in Rhode Island. A state-chartered bank, Washington Trust offers a full range of financial services, including business banking , personal banking , and wealth management and trust services through its offices located in Rhode Island, Southeastern Connecticut and Massachusetts. The Corporation's common stock trades on The NASDAQ Stock Market under the symbol WASH. Web site address: www.washtrust.com.
